Admiral Isoroku Yamamoto's encrypted flight itinerary traveled through Japan's "unbreakable" JN-25 naval code on April 13, 1943. American codebreakers at Station HYPO in Pearl Harbor decrypted it in less than 24 hours, revealing departure time (0600), route coordinates, aircraft type (two G4M Betty bombers), fighter escort strength (6 Zeros), and arrival time (0945) at Ballale Airfield. The gap between Japanese confidence and American intelligence wasn't close—it was absolute. Japan thought their codes were impenetrable. America was reading their most sensitive military traffic like morning newspapers and planning assassinations based on breakfast itineraries. Japanese naval command transmitted Yamamoto's inspection tour details believing their encryption systems—complex substitution codes with thousands of possible combinations—were mathematically unbreakable. What they didn't know: American cryptanalysts had been reading JN-25 traffic since mid-1942, processing intercepts through IBM tabulating machines at speeds Japanese code clerks couldn't imagine. Every "secret" convoy route, every "confidential" operation order, every "encrypted" command message—all compromised. Encrypted message sent: April 13. Decrypted: April 13. P-38s dispatched: April 17. Yamamoto killed: April 18, 0943 hours—2 minutes before scheduled landing.
